Mrs. Minnie F. HELVEY, 90, Akron, died at 6:10 p.m. Tuesday, September 5, 1978 at Canterbury Manor nursing home.

She was born Dec. 5, 1887 in Liberty Mills and had lived in Akron most of her life. She was married Aug. 3, 1912 in Roann to Claude HELVEY. She was a member of the Akron Church of God, where she had served as caretaker.

Surviving are a brother, Ray POTTENGER, Peru, and a sister, Mrs. Bessie PROVINCES, Roann. Three brothers and two sisters preceded in death.

Services will be at 1:30 p.m. Friday at the Akron Church of God, with the Rev. James HALL officiating. Burial will be in the I.O.O.F. cemetery, Roann. Friends may call at the Sheetz funeral home, Akron, after 2 p.m. Thursday.

Rochester Sentinel - September 6, 1978

********************************************

Minnie and Claude lived next door to the Akron Church of God for years after they moved to town. Upon Minnie's death, she willed the property to the Akron Church of God and is now part of the church.
